Abstract
The reaction of the cycloneophylplatinum complex Pt(CH 2 CMe 2 C 6 H 4 )(NN), 1, with PhCHBr 2 gave the corresponding complex PtBr 2 (CH 2 CMe 2 C 6 H 4 CHPh)(NN).
